Hardwood Replacement in Annandale, NJ
Hardwood replacement services involve removing damaged, worn, or outdated hardwood flooring and installing new planks to restore the appearance and functionality of a space. These projects typically include replacing sections of hardwood due to water damage, staining issues, or general wear and tear, as well as complete floor overhauls for aesthetic upgrades. Homeowners often seek this service to improve the look of their interiors, address uneven or squeaky floors, or prepare a property for sale by ensuring the flooring is in excellent condition.
Property owners considering hardwood replacement should understand the different types of wood and finishes available, as well as the scope of work involved in removing old flooring and installing new material seamlessly. It’s also important to evaluate the condition of subflooring, as it can impact the durability and appearance of the new hardwood. Clarifying expectations about the style, color, and quality of the replacement flooring can help ensure the project aligns with the desired outcome.

Common Hardwood Replacement Jobs
Hardwood Replacement - involves removing damaged or worn hardwood floors and installing new planks.
Floor Repair - addresses issues like deep scratches, stains, or loose boards to restore appearance.
Partial Replacement - replaces specific sections of hardwood flooring to match existing material.
Full Floor Replacement - involves removing entire existing flooring for a complete upgrade.
Subfloor Preparation - ensures the underlying surface is level and stable before new hardwood installation.
Refinishing and Sanding - prepares the surface for replacement by smoothing and restoring the existing hardwood.
Hardwood Replacement Questions
What types of flooring can be replaced with hardwood? Hardwood replacement services typically involve replacing damaged or worn flooring with new hardwood planks, suitable for most residential and commercial spaces.
When is hardwood replacement necessary? Replacement is recommended when existing flooring is severely damaged, stained, or warped beyond repair, affecting the appearance and safety of the space.
What should property owners consider before choosing hardwood replacement? It's important to select the right hardwood type, finish, and color to match the property's style and existing decor.
Can hardwood be replaced in specific areas like stairs or custom layouts? Yes, hardwood replacement can be tailored to fit areas such as staircases, intricate patterns, or unique room configurations for a seamless look.
